Some of the only requirements to work as an HCA are that you are over the age of 18, pass a Department of Social and Health Services (DSHS) background check, and meet training requirements. The Home Care Curricul um (HCC) is a 40 -hour minimum basic training course, exclusive of testing, containing 12 discrete content areas or modules. Interpreters available for the written examination -The Department of Health offers the home care aide examination in the following languages: Amharic, Arabic, Chinese, English, Khmer, Korean, Laotian, Russian, Samoan, Spanish, Somali, Tagalog, Ukrainian and Vietnamese. Under the revised regulations, effective January 1, 2015, third party employers, such as home care agencies, may not claim the overtime exemption for live-in domestic service workers, and must pay such workers at least the federal minimum wage for all hours worked and overtime pay at one and a half times the regular rate of pay for all hours .
